Three months later...
Western Shu, Celestial Cloud City...
In the Ghostly Cyan Robe Tower, the Solitary Bamboo Gang and the Cyan Robe Tower are the two major gangs in the Jianghu across the three cities and twenty-six counties, both headquartered in Celestial Cloud City.
As the saying goes, "Two tigers cannot share one mountain," these two gangs naturally have many conflicts.
It’s impossible for anyone to stop these two gangs from fighting each other.
Not even the government!
Just like when tigers fight, whoever intervenes will only end up dead for nothing.
Yet at this moment, the scheduled battle between the two major gangs has come to an unexpected halt.
Everyone looks in disbelief at that spot.
"Miss... Miss... Are you alright?"
A wild man with disheveled hair and a face full of stubble is holding the leader of Ghostly Cyan Robe Tower for today—Hua Linglong.
Hua Linglong holds a prestigious position in the Ghostly Cyan Robe Tower. Perhaps her personal power isn’t strong, but the group of old subordinates left by her late father all belong to her faction.
Moreover, she is quite famous in the Jianghu as a beautiful lady, known as the "Snow Jade Peony."
The phrase "Celestial Cloud Mountain City, Ghostly Cyan Robe, Snow Jade Peony" is enough to stir the hearts of all men in this area.
Hua Linglong likes to wear white clothes, white skirts, and white socks, her demeanor pure and pitiful, with extremely elegant speech, always evoking a strong protective instinct in others.
No one is willing to kill such a woman.
But in today’s battle, the Solitary Bamboo Gang has set up a trap to kill Hua Linglong.
Because the Solitary Bamboo Gang discovered that Hua Linglong is not only beautiful but also one of the Core Figures of the Ghostly Cyan Robe Tower.
If she were killed, then... the Ghostly Cyan Robe Tower could very likely fall into chaos.
However, just as two top experts of the Solitary Bamboo Gang, along with an inside man they painstakingly bribed, launched a combined attack to kill Hua Linglong, a wild man suddenly emerged from the woods nearby.
This wild man moved in bizarre ways, with strange postures, yet he skillfully defused the deadly strike against Hua Linglong and held her by the waist, retreating backward.
At this moment...
Outside the city, the winter snow has melted, and the early spring rain from last night knocked down a lot of peach blossoms.
With a gust of wind, the petals began to flutter.
The Solitary Bamboo Gang and the inside man refused to stop, quickly closing in, with a saber, a sword, and an axe all continuing toward Hua Linglong.
The wild man placed Hua Linglong aside, bowing his head to search for something.
Having narrowly escaped death, Hua Linglong, still in shock, quickly untied her belt, pushed it forward, and said, "Use mine!"
The wild man did not refuse, directly taking the sword, drawing it.
The blade emerged an inch, glistening coldly, and when fully drawn, shone bright.
In the brightness, the wild man struck someone with one slash, and after three dances of the blade, all three of the top experts in Jianghu lay injured on the ground, their eyes wide with shock as they looked at the wild man.
Hua Linglong’s eyes also shone brightly.
She could see that the wild man’s swordsmanship was terrifyingly powerful, the peak of technique, naturally seamless.
The wild man, disheveled and dirty, yet the more she looked, the happier she became.
Because after those three people fell, the Solitary Bamboo Gang advanced again, but this wild man stood in front of her, and no matter who... could not bypass this wild man to harm her.
Initially, she suspected that this wild man might be a Loose Cultivator, but after a few slashes, she completely dismissed that possibility.
No cultivator could possibly have such formidable martial arts mastery.
Her eyes burned with passion.
That was the fire of ambition...
Heaven had sent this wild man to her, and she would definitely seize this opportunity well.
Amidst the flashing blades and swords, she slowly touched a Jade Bottle hidden in her bosom.
The bottle contained a mysterious poison in the Jianghu—"Blood-Burning Divine Water".
This "Blood-Burning Divine Water" is colorless and tasteless, allowing those who practice martial arts and body forging to achieve more with less, but if not taken with an antidote monthly, the blood burns itself, leading to a painful death.
"Blood-Burning Divine Water" was originally a secret poison from Cold Water Manor...
It’s said that the old master of the manor discovered a recipe by chance in his early years and concocted it.
However, although Cold Water Manor possessed this poison, they rarely used it, living a low-profile life in the mountains and forests.
But at the beginning of last year, the manor was suddenly massacred, men and women, old and young, not even chickens and dogs were spared. And the secret poison disappeared without a trace; some said Cold Water Manor never had the poison, and it was all just a rumor.
But the one who spread the rumor was Hua Linglong.
The one who massacred Cold Water Manor was also Hua Linglong.
The one who killed all those in the know was Hua Linglong.
